About this property
Serene Mountain Retreat Room with Stunning Continental Divide Views
Serene Mountain Retreat with Stunning Continental Divide Views
Welcome to our fully STR-licensed Boulder County retreat, nestled at 8,000 feet on Sugarloaf Mountain within Roosevelt National Forest. This bright and cozy garden-level bedroom with a private bathroom offers a serene escape about 20 minutes (10 miles) from downtown Boulder and 8 miles from Nederland. Perfect for solo travelers, adventurers, romantic getaways, or someone looking for a nature reset, this space is your ideal base for exploring Boulder and surrounding areas stunning landscapes.
Property Highlights:
• Private Bedroom & Bathroom: Enjoy a key-locking bedroom with southern light, breathtaking mountain views, and privacy blinds. Features luxury be linens, robes, and cozy throws. The adjacent private bathroom includes spa-quality shower products and soft luxury towels.
• In-Room Amenities: Microwave, Keurig with complimentary coffee pods and sweeteners, mini fridge, free Wi-Fi, and Roku TV for your streaming subscriptions.
• Outdoor Oasis: Relax on a flagstone patio with a double glider, and 2 chairs surrounded by aspens, pines, and panoramic Continental Divide views. The 1.25-acre property features rolling natural grounds and rock gardens, perfect for soaking in the serene environment.
• Prime Location: Hike directly from the property to Sugarloaf Mountain, Dream Canyon, or Switzerland Trail. Close to Eldora Ski Area (25 min), Rocky Mountain National Park (45 min), Brainard Lake, Indian Peaks Wilderness, and Red Rocks Amphitheater (45 min). Just 15 minutes from Wedgwood Weddings venue on Canyon Blvd.
Guest Access:
• Private entrance through a family room (no access to kitchen, laundry, or family room).
• One reserved parking space at the top just off the gravel driveway; a short walk down driveway to stairs is required to reach the entrance. No trailers, campers, or street parking allowed.
• 420-friendly patio; no tobacco products permitted on the property.
Important Details:
• Elevation & Climate: At 8,000 feet, nights are cooler (no AC; box and tabletop fans provided). Pack for variable weather and use provided robes/throws for comfort. Heat available spring/fall (please keep doors closed and turn off when not in use; no heat mid-June to mid-September).
• Water Conservation: On well and septic; please limit showers to 10 minutes and avoid flushing feminine products, wipes, food, or hair.
• Road & Vehicle: Paved roads lead to a 2/10-mile dirt road to the house. 2WD is fine in summer; 4WD recommended in fall, winter, or spring due to potential snow. Uphill traffic has right-of-way on narrow neighborhood roads.
• Wildlife: Moose, elk, deer, wild turkeys, bobcats, bears, chipmunks, birds, and hummingbirds frequent the area. Lock vehicles and avoid leaving food inside.
• Pets: We have a No PETS Policy do to allergies.
*Health & Safety: We follow strict CDC cleaning and disinfecting protocols for your peace of mind.
Why Stay Here? Surrounded by the beauty of Roosevelt National Forest, this tranquil retreat offers direct access to hiking, skiing, and iconic Colorado attractions. The scenic drive up Boulder Canyon along Boulder Creek sets the stage for a peaceful escape. Whether you’re exploring the Peak to Peak Highway, enjoying live music at The Caribou Room, or unwinding with mountain views, this space is your home away from home.
